Precision chrome plating

Achieving hard chrome plating on ultra-fine pores and complex shapes! Hard chrome plating on ultra-fine pore inner diameters of φ1mm×100mm.

This is an introduction to our "Precision Chrome Plating" services. With our "Hard Chrome Plating Technology for Ultra-Fine Pores," we have achieved hard chrome plating for ultra-fine pore inner diameters of φ1mm×100mm. This service is utilized by many customers for surface treatment in fine pores, which often present numerous challenges. Our "High-Precision Thickness Control Technology for Hard Chrome Plating" allows us to precisely control the plating thickness even at the tips of rail components using specially developed jigs. Antenna coil hard steel wire SW-CΦ0.8 tin-plated

Hard steel wire has lower durability compared to piano wire, but it is a material that is easy to process and inexpensive.

This product is used as an antenna rather than as a so-called spring. The material used is "hard steel wire, SW-C." A representative of iron-based spring materials is piano wire. Piano wire is used for springs that require severe durability, such as clutch springs and brake springs. Hard steel wire has lower durability compared to piano wire, but it is a cost-effective material with good workability. It is mainly used for springs under static loads, as well as for fittings and wire forming products. (For static loads, please refer to the related links.) Melted zinc-aluminum alloy coating "MAG+1"

Significant extension of the lifespan of metal products is achievable! High corrosion-resistant plating for salt damage areas.

The molten zinc-aluminum alloy coating "MAG+1" is a high corrosion-resistant coating formed by immersing in a plating bath of zinc - 5% aluminum - 1% magnesium. It significantly extends the lifespan of metal items in harsh corrosive environments such as areas with severe salt damage. 【Features】 ■ Long lifespan ■ Salt damage countermeasures ■ Volcanic gas countermeasures ■ Spring water damage countermeasures For more details, please refer to the catalog or feel free to contact us.
